About Lu Xiangyang
Lu Xiangyang was working at a local branch of the People's Bank of China in 1995 when he teamed up with his cousin Wang Chuanfu to start BYD, then a battery maker.
Lu is now vice chairman of the company, which has overtaken Tesla as the largest EV maker by sales.
Lu also runs his own investment firm, Youngy Investment Holding Group.
